Output 6a27eba25f80cc3bb61b8578bd40dbfae89c6a0cc67b24361980f2e1faa72038:3
- value
- 2581656
- script pubkey
- OP_0 OP_PUSHBYTES_20 88d2b6a20ab2efdf69c577f58343b327ebd7e89d
- address
- bc1q3rftdgs2ktha76w9wl6cxsanyl4a06yag46mvr
- transaction
- 6a27eba25f80cc3bb61b8578bd40dbfae89c6a0cc67b24361980f2e1faa72038